Rochioli. Allen. Two names that define Russian River Valley Pinot Noir — together in one wine.
Gary Farrell's Rochioli-Allen is one of the winery's most storied bottlings, drawing fruit from two of the Russian River Valley's most celebrated vineyard properties. Winemaker Theresa Heredia works with 100% Pinot Noir from these sites to produce a wine of characteristic elegance — light on its feet, precise in its flavours, and built for the table rather than the trophy cabinet. The 2019 vintage delivered exceptional balance across the appellation.
Tasting Notes
Light-bodied and immediately charming on the nose, with red cherry, cranberry, tangerine, and lemon blossom that draw you in with delicacy rather than power. On the palate, those flavours weave together on a tangy, refreshing texture that feels effortless — this is Pinot Noir at its most graceful, where restraint is the point and every element is in its right place.
The Finish
Clean and tangy, with red cherry and a citrus lift that carries through to a refreshing close. A wine that makes you reach for another glass rather than another thought.
What the Critics Say
- Wine Enthusiast: 92 points — "Light-bodied and delicate... weaves red cherry, cranberry, tangerine and lemon blossom flavors deftly on a tangy, refreshing texture."
